Quest Kenmare is a one-day multi-adventure sports race which encompasses the amazing mountains of the Beara Peninsula and boutique charm of Kenmare Town. Run, cycle and kayak across the spectacular mountains and valleys to challenge yourself in 2018. Choose from 3 routes, there's one to suit all levels of fitness, the 67k Expert, 50K Sport and 29K Challenge. Routes take in Kenmare Bay, Gleninchiquin, The Beara Peninsula, Caha Pass and Kenmare town. Quest Kenmare will bring you to places of Ireland you have never been before. New and untested routes through 200-foot waterfalls, secret valleys and ancient mountain trails. Kayaks are provided as part of the entry fee. Participants will receive exclusive custom-made medals as well as a Quest branded piece of clothing. The finish line boasts hot food for all competitors, the famouse Japanese hot tubs as well as a recovery zone. The first of the Quest Adventure Race Series for 2018 it is sure to be very popular with experienced adventure racers as well as those new to the sport.
